Understanding the Basics of Staph Skin Infection
Staphylococcus bacteria, commonly known as staph, are a group of germs often found on the skin or in the nose of healthy people. Usually harmless in these locations, they can cause trouble when they invade deeper layers of the skin through cuts, scrapes, or other breaches. This invasion triggers what we call a Staph Skin Infection.
These infections range from minor annoyances like pimples and boils to more serious conditions such as cellulitis or abscesses. The infection’s severity depends on factors like the strain of staph bacteria involved and the person’s immune response. Some strains have developed resistance to common antibiotics, making treatment more challenging.
The most common culprit is Staphylococcus aureus, including methicillin-resistant Staphylococcus aureus (MRSA), which demands particular attention due to its resistance profile. Understanding how these infections develop and spread is key to managing and preventing them effectively.
Common Types of Staph Skin Infections
Staph infections manifest in various forms on the skin. Each type has distinct characteristics but generally shares symptoms like redness, warmth, pain, and swelling.
Folliculitis
Folliculitis occurs when staph bacteria infect hair follicles. It appears as small red bumps or white-headed pimples around hair follicles. While usually mild and self-limiting, it can become painful or spread if left untreated.
Boils (Furuncles)
A boil is a deeper infection around a hair follicle that forms a painful lump filled with pus. It often requires drainage for relief and healing. Boils can cluster into larger abscesses known as carbuncles.
Impetigo
Impetigo is a highly contagious superficial infection mostly affecting children. It presents as red sores that rupture easily and form honey-colored crusts. Prompt treatment prevents spread within families or communities.
Cellulitis
Cellulitis is an infection of deeper layers of skin and underlying tissue. It causes diffuse redness, swelling, warmth, and tenderness over a large area. Without timely treatment, cellulitis can lead to serious complications such as sepsis.
Abscesses
An abscess is a localized collection of pus within tissues caused by staph bacteria. It often needs surgical drainage alongside antibiotics for complete resolution.
How Staph Skin Infections Spread
Staph bacteria thrive on human skin but become problematic when they enter through broken skin barriers. Transmission occurs mainly through direct contact with infected wounds or contaminated surfaces.
Crowded environments like gyms, locker rooms, or dormitories increase exposure risk due to shared equipment or close skin contact. Personal hygiene lapses also contribute significantly to spreading these infections.
The bacteria can survive on objects such as towels, razors, or clothing for extended periods. This resilience makes proper cleaning and disinfection critical in preventing outbreaks.
The Role of Carrier State
Many people carry staph bacteria harmlessly in their noses or on their skin without symptoms—this is called being a carrier. Carriers can unknowingly transmit staph to others or develop infections themselves if the bacteria penetrate the skin barrier.
Healthcare workers are often screened for MRSA carriage because they pose a transmission risk in medical settings where vulnerable patients reside.
Symptoms That Signal a Staph Skin Infection
Recognizing early signs helps catch infections before they worsen. Common symptoms include:
- Redness: The infected area usually appears inflamed.
- Swelling: Tissue around the infection site may puff up noticeably.
- Pain or tenderness: Touching the infected spot often hurts.
- Pus formation: White-yellowish fluid may ooze from boils or sores.
- Warmth: The affected area feels warmer than surrounding skin.
- Fever: In severe cases, systemic symptoms like fever and chills arise.
If you notice rapidly spreading redness or intense pain accompanied by fever, immediate medical attention is crucial as these signs may indicate serious infection requiring urgent care.
Treatment Approaches for Staph Skin Infection
Treating staph infections depends on severity and type but generally involves antibiotics and wound care measures.
Mild Infections
For minor folliculitis or small boils:
- Warm compresses: Applying heat helps draw out pus and reduce discomfort.
- Topical antibiotics: Creams like mupirocin may be prescribed.
- Good hygiene: Keeping the area clean prevents spread.
Most mild infections resolve within days with proper care.
Moderate to Severe Infections
More extensive cellulitis or abscesses require:
- Oral antibiotics: Drugs targeting staph strains are given for several days.
- Surgical drainage: Abscesses often need incision and drainage procedures.
- Pain management: Over-the-counter analgesics help control discomfort.
In cases involving MRSA strains, specific antibiotics like clindamycin or doxycycline are preferred based on susceptibility testing results.
The Challenge of Antibiotic Resistance
MRSA strains resist many standard antibiotics including methicillin and penicillin derivatives. This resistance complicates treatment choices and necessitates culture-guided therapy.
Failure to complete prescribed antibiotic courses encourages resistant strains’ emergence; hence adherence is vital for successful outcomes.

The Science Behind Diagnosis Techniques
Accurate diagnosis informs proper treatment plans for Staph Skin Infection cases:
- Culturing samples: Swabs from lesions undergo laboratory culture to identify bacterial species and antibiotic sensitivities.
- Molecular testing (PCR): Detects bacterial DNA quickly; useful in hospital settings for MRSA screening.
- Blood tests:If systemic involvement suspected – blood cultures help detect bacteremia (bacteria in bloodstream).
- Sensitivity assays:This determines which antibiotics will effectively kill the infecting strain without resistance issues.
Timely diagnosis reduces complications by guiding targeted therapy rather than broad-spectrum guesswork.
The Impact of Staph Skin Infection on Public Health
Staphylococcal infections represent a significant burden worldwide due to their frequency and potential severity. Hospitalizations related to complicated infections strain healthcare resources extensively every year.
Community-associated MRSA has emerged outside hospitals causing outbreaks among athletes, military recruits, schoolchildren—highlighting how easily this pathogen crosses boundaries between healthcare facilities and everyday life environments alike.
Public health campaigns emphasize hygiene education along with surveillance programs tracking resistant strains’ prevalence trends globally—aiming at containment before widespread epidemics occur.

The Road Ahead: Managing Complications Promptly
Untreated or poorly managed staph infections sometimes escalate into life-threatening conditions such as sepsis or necrotizing fasciitis—a rapidly spreading soft tissue infection destroying muscle fascia requiring emergency surgery.
Other complications include:
- Lymphangitis: inflammation spreading along lymph vessels causing red streaks towards lymph nodes;
- Bacteremia: systemic bloodstream invasion risking organ damage;
- Pneumonia: secondary lung infections from hematogenous spread;
- Toxic shock syndrome: rare but severe toxin-mediated illness associated with certain strains;
Early recognition combined with aggressive treatment minimizes these risks dramatically.
